Scheme 7 shows how trisaccharides were prepared on a radiation-grafted polymer surface.20 The photolabile 4-hydroxymethyl-3-nitrobenzamido handle21 and jV-iodosuccinimide-triethylsilyltriflate coupling chemistry were used. Product purities were similar to those obtained using Tentagel macrobeads. [Pg.206]

Expanding the variety and properties of linker groups increases the scope of practical applications of radiation-grafted polymer surfaces for the parallel synthesis of organic compounds. Linker molecules have a bearing on the types of reactions that can be performed and the ease of isolation of products after cleavage. [Pg.208]

Mimotopes has been involved in the development, use, and commercialization of radiation-grafted polymer surfaces for multiple parallel synthesis since the late 1980s.10-12 Although other workers have reported the use of radiation-graft polymers in solid-phase synthesis,13,14 as far as we are aware, the graft polymer devices manufactured and sold by Mimotopes (SynPhase Crowns, SynPhase Lanterns) are the only current commercial products of this type. These products are presented in Fig. 1. The SynPhase Lanterns are the current design for small molecule synthesis. The initial... [Pg.40]
